Camp Kitchen Nest Information

In my opinion, this shape and volume (750 ml) is the perfect size for hiking. First, you don't need much more water, even water-heavy camping meals usually don't need more than 16 ounces (500 ml). I was originally considering 500ml, but it's too small to hold fuel and a stove. I also recommend this particular shape. There are some wider 750ml kettles out there, but a) they don't have enough height to accommodate fuel and a stovetop, and b) they're clumsy for drinking coffee. This product seems to be an exact match for Toakes in terms of material and size. it's just cheaper. The quality seems excellent so far. It's well made, the lid slides fairly firmly, removing easily but just enough not to accidentally detach. Some have mentioned that it might not be titanium. I'm pretty sure you can't get that much weight with aluminum. As for nesting, with a 4-ounce can of fuel there's still plenty of room at the bottom for a small stove and lighter. See photo, I have an MSR Pocket Rocket 2 and it fits great with room for a lighter and a small flimsy towel.
